Editor:

I am a true blue community booster and shop locally regularly, especially at Christmas time.

On Dec. 3, I was completely done my Christmas shopping. Yes, I make a list. And yes, I start early — and I shop locally.

We keep our Christmas giving simple — keeping to mostly items like books, music (CDs), consumables, special Christmas tree ornaments and items to wear. We purchase things from school groups raising money such as chocolates from the Chatelech grad class and poinsettias from the Elphi grad class. We donate to local charities — a gift to family and friends who have everything. We give the gift of entertainment — tickets to a ballet or concert — on the Coast and off. I make handmade ornaments and jams. We find most everything for our friends and family right here on the Coast. When was the last time you strolled Cowrie Street or Gibsons Landing? We are so fortunate to have such unique, friendly and specialty stores on the Sunshine Coast.

I challenge everyone to do the same, and I guarantee you will find something for everyone on your Christmas list plus boost our local economy. It is a very satisfying feeling during the Christmas season.

Sherryl Latimer, Sechelt
